Eviction Protection for Households
Facing eviction can be a devastating circumstance for families, leaving them exposed. Fortunately, there are initiatives available to provide vital economic assistance during these challenging times. Community agencies often offer subsidies to help families cover their rent and avoid eviction.
In addition, there are nonprofit organizations that provide a range of help, such as legal aid help to prevent eviction and housing counseling. It's essential for families facing eviction to inquire about these resources as soon as possible.
Facing Eviction: Legal Assistance & Support
Confronting eviction can be a stressful experience. If you're battling an eviction, know that you have options available to help. There are diverse legal support programs and organizations committed to protecting tenants' rights.
Finding legal help is crucial in an eviction case. A competent attorney can explain your legal standing, review your lease, and advocate for you in court.
Beyond legal assistance, various resources exist that can offer monetary help, accommodation options, and counseling.
Consider the following:
- Local legal societies
- Housing advocacy organizations
- Nonprofit agencies
- State housing departments
Remember, you don't have to face eviction alone.

Battling Evictions: Fight Back and Stay in Your Home
Are individuals you know facing eviction? It can be a difficult time, but understand that you have rights. Legal aid is available to help you fight back and stay in their homes. Legal aid providers can offer free or low-cost legal representation. They can guide people in this situation understand the eviction process, question unfair practices, and consider alternatives.
- Avoid put off seeking legal aid. The sooner you reach out with a legal aid organization, the better your chances of successfully defending your housing.
- Understand that you are not alone. Many individuals have faced eviction and positively fought back with the help of legal aid.
